Age Ain't Nothing but a Number is the debut studio album by American
R&B singer
Aaliyah, released under
Jive and
Blackground Records on May 24, 1994, in the United States. After being signed by her uncle
Barry Hankerson, Aaliyah was introduced to recording artist and producer
R. Kelly. He became her
mentor, as well as the lead songwriter and producer of the album. The duo recorded the album at the
Chicago Recording Company in
Chicago,
Illinois. The album featured two hit singles, including the top ten-charting "
Back & Forth" and "
At Your Best (You Are Love)"; both singles were certified
Goldby the
Recording Industry Association of America(RIAA). One additional single followed in the US: "
Age Ain't Nothing but a Number". Two more singles were released internationally after "Age Ain't Nothing But a Number": "
Down with the Clique" and "
The Thing I Like".
